Okay sorry for being a bit ****, but which Z51 rear sway bar are you looking for?
'97-99 C5 Z51 21.7mm
'00-04 C5 Z51 23.6mm (same as the '01-04 Z06)
or the C6 Z51 25.6mm
Since you stated that you have a C5 Z06 and wanted to "upgrade", I would have to presume you are looking for a C6 Z51 25.6mm rear sway bar - correct?

I purchased front and rear sways from link below, everything looks great. Just need to install this spring.
https://www.gmoemautoparts.com/oem-p...SABEgKh4PD_BwE
Genuine GM C6Z51 Sway Bar
25919502 – Front stabilizer bar
10339124 – Rear stabilizer bar
10387838 – Front stabilizer bar bushings (2)
15241135 – Rear stabilizer bar bushings (2)
